The Medical Counselling Committee (MCC) will conduct the DU CW quota MBBS admissions 2026. Candidates seeking admission under CW category will have to apply for MCC NEET 2026 counselling for 85% Delhi quota seats. Only NEET 2026 qualified are eligible to apply for DU MBBS admission 2026 under CW quota. There is a 5% reservation for the candidates applying for DU MBBS admission under CW quota. Candidates who are allotted a seat through MCC NEET 2026 counselling have to fill the application form and upload the prescribed documents within specified time period. The Children/Widows (CW) Quota is a reservation category for the dependents of Defence personnel. Candidates belonging to this category are considered for admission under specific reservation provisions after qualifying NEET UG. Candidates wishing admission under DU CW quota, have to qualify for the medical entrance exam, and appear for the MCC NEET counselling. Once candidates are allotted a seat through MCC under 85% DU quota, they have to fill an application form at the FMSC website.
Candidates applying for MBBS seats under CW quota in DU, have to fulfill the below mentioned eligibility criteria:
Candidates must be of 17 years of age as on December 31, 2026.
Candidates must have qualified for the NEET 2026 exam.
Candidates must have passed Classes 11 and 12 from a recognized board through a school located in the National Capital Territory (NCT) of Delhi.
Applicants must be physically fit.
The DU MBBS admission 2026 for CW quota is conducted by the MCC. If candidates are allotted an MBBS seat in DU through NEET counselling, they have to complete the registration process at FMSC portal. The DU MBBS application form for 85% CW quota seats is released in online mode. Candidates have to follow the below mentioned steps for DU CW quota MBBS 2026 application form filling.
Go to the official website: fmsc.du.ac.in.
Go to ‘Courses -> Undergraduate Courses (MBBS/BDS)’ and click on the MBBS/BDS Admission link.
Click on the online registration link available under the ‘Course Updates- UG (MBBS/BDS)’ section.
As a first-time user, create a new account by entering your NEET 2026 roll number and date of birth.
Verify the displayed details and click ‘Confirm’ if all the information is correct.
Enter a valid mobile number and email ID, as these will be used for future admission-related communication.
Create a password for the registration account and complete the registration.
Log in using your registered email ID and password to fill out the online admission form.
Check all the entered details carefully, as changes are not allowed after submission.
Click on ‘Save’ and proceed to upload the required documents, photograph, and signature.
Pay the prescribed registration DU MBBS registration fee 2026 online and submit the application form.

Candidates allotted a seat in MBBS course under Delhi University are required to execute a Surety Bond of Rs3 lakh with two sureties at the time of provisional admission. Admission is considered valid only after the surety bond is submitted in the prescribed format. The DU MBBS admission surety bond format is made available at the official website of FMSC. The surety bond amount is payable in the following situations:
If a candidate surrenders the allotted seat after joining the institute in violation of the MCC rules.
If a candidate leaves the MBBS course before completing it.
If the admission or registration is cancelled by the University due to unsatisfactory academic performance, misconduct, or indiscipline.
